Exmouth Station Facilities and Services

Exmouth Train Station is designed to ensure a smooth experience for travelers, providing a range of amenities for convenience and support. The ticket office operates from 07:10 to 15:25 on weekdays and Saturdays, making ticket purchases and collections straightforward, even though there are no opening hours specified for Sundays. For those who prefer digital solutions, ticket machines are available and accessible, supporting online collection and smartcard issuances.

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access across the station, ensuring easy movement for all passengers. An induction loop is present for hearing assistance, and help points are situated for immediate assistance. However, please note that there are no waiting rooms, nor is there luggage storage available. CCTV is installed to uphold safety and security around the clock.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Millbrook (Hants) station is quite modest in terms of facilities. There's no traditional ticket office or ticket machines available, which means the purchase and collection of tickets must be done in advance online, or you can utilize the Permit to Travel machine. This machine requires you to exchange your purchased permit for a ticket on the train itself. An induction loop is available, and while there is no waiting room, seating area, or first-class lounge, the station does offer customer help points for inquiries. Although staff help at the station isn't provided, you can reach out to the Customer Service Centre at 0345 6000 650.

Accessibility and Support

Accessibility at Millbrook (Hants) may present a challenge for those requiring step-free access, as the station is categorized as having no such facility. However, there are ramps for train access, and assistance can be arranged with the train guards for boarding and alighting. It is advisable to book assistance up to two hours before your journey when traveling with South Western Railway, although impromptu requests can be managed on-site.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ting areas, you can make use of the public Wi-Fi to stay connected during your wait.

Getting Around

Transport links to and from the station are straightforward. A rail replacement service is available, with buses stopping outside the station on the slip road from Waterloo Road to Mountbatten Way (A33) for travel to Totton/Romsey, or on Mountbatten Way by Lakelands Drive for journeys heading towards Southampton. For planning ahead, downloadable bus route information is available from National Rail. While taxi services aren’t listed directly at Millbrook (Hants), nearby bus stop locations provide ample options to kickstart your journey into Southampton or beyond.
